+/* BM driver configuration */
+struct gr1553bm_config {
+
+ /*** Time options ***/
+
+ /* 8-bit time resolution, the BM will update the time according
+ * to this setting. 0 will make the time tag be of highest
+ * resolution (no division), 1 will make the BM increment the
+ * time tag once for two time ticks (div with 2), etc.
+ */
+ uint8_t time_resolution;
+
+ /* Enable Time Overflow IRQ handling. Setting this to 1
+ * makes the driver to update the 64-bit time by it self,
+ * it will use time overflow IRQ to detect when the 64-bit
+ * time counter must be incremented.
+ *
+ * If set to zero, the driver expect the user to call
+ * gr1553bm_time() regularly, it must be called more often
+ * than the time overflows to avoid an incorrect time.
+ */
+ int time_ovf_irq;
+
+
+
+ /*** Filtering options ***/
+
+ /* Bus error log options
+ *
+ * bit0,4-31 = reserved, set to zero
+ * Bit1 = Enables logging of Invalid mode code errors
+ * Bit2 = Enables logging of Unexpected Data errors
+ * Bit3 = Enables logging of Manchester/parity errors
+ */
+ unsigned int filt_error_options;
+
+ /* RT Address filtering bit mask. Each bit enables (if set)
+ * logging of a certain RT sub address. Bit 31 enables logging
+ * of broadcast messages.
+ */
+ unsigned int filt_rtadr;
+
+ /* RT Subaddress filtering bit mask, bit definition:
+ * 31: Enables logging of mode commands on subadr 31
+ * 1..30: BitN enables/disables logging of RT subadr N
+ * 0: Enables logging of mode commands on subadr 0
+ */
+ unsigned int filt_subadr;
+
+ /* Mode code Filter, is written into "BM RT Mode code filter"
+ * register, please see hardware manual for bit declarations.
+ */
+ unsigned int filt_mc;
+
+
+
+ /*** Buffer options ***/
+
+ /* Size of buffer in bytes, must be aligned to 8-byte
+ * The size is limited to max 4Mb.
+ */
+ unsigned int buffer_size;
+
+ /* Custom buffer, must be aligned to 8-byte and be of buffer_size
+ * length. If NULL dynamic memory allocation is used.
+ */
+ void *buffer_custom;
+
+ /* Custom Copy function, may be used to implement a more
+ * effective way of copying the DMA buffer. For example
+ * the DMA log may need to be compressed before copied
+ * onto a storage, this function can be used to avoid an
+ * extra copy.
+ */
+ bmcopy_func_t copy_func;
+
+ /* Optional Custom Data passed on to copy_func() */
+ void *copy_func_arg;
+
+
+
+ /*** Interrupt options ***/
+
+ /* Custom DMA error function, note that this function is called
+ * from Interrupt Context. Set to NULL to disable this callback.
+ */
+ bmisr_func_t dma_error_isr;
+
+ /* Optional Custom Data passed on to dma_error_isr() */
+ void *dma_error_arg;
+};

+/* Get 64-bit 1553 Time. Low 24-bit time is acquired from BM hardware,
+ * the MSB is taken from a software counter internal to the driver. The
+ * counter is incremented every time the Time overflows by:
+ * - using "Time overflow" IRQ if enabled in user configuration
+ * - by checking IRQ flag (IRQ disabled), it is required that user
+ * calls this function before the next time overflow.
+ *
+ * The BM timer is limited to 24-bits, in order to handle overflows
+ * correctly and maintain a valid time an Interrupt handler is used
+ * or this function must be called when IRQ is not used.
+ *
+ * Update software time counters and return the current time.
+ */
+extern void gr1553bm_time(void *bm, uint64_t *time);
